Skateboarding fashion brand Supreme is celebrating its 30th anniversary by releasing a three-volume monograph titled "30 Years: T-Shirts 1994-2024."

The book will catalogue every T-shirt released by Supreme in its 30-year history and will be sold together in a slipcase.

T-shirts have played a significant role in Supreme's history since its inception. The first Supreme store opened on Lafayette St. in 1994, and some of the first products produced and sold by the brand were T-shirts.

Over the years, Supreme has used T-shirts to celebrate the opening of new stores, pay tribute to cultural icons such as Lou Reed and Kermit the Frog, and develop its unique and irreverent voice.

The three-volume monograph will be available from April 25th, with Japan and Seoul having access to the book from April 27th.
